Surrounded by his loving family, Bill Reed went to be with the Lord on October 2, 2010, at age 81. Bill was born August 8, 1929 to parents Harry and Mary (Schafer) Reed, who preceded him in death. Bill was also preceded in death by 3 brothers and 3 sisters. He is survived by his loving wife of 61 years, Joyce (Thompson) Reed; 3 daughters, Anna (Robert) Neher of DeWitt, Colleen (Gary) Strickland, of Mason, Carol (Bill) Bensinger, of Bath; 5 sons, James (Lynn) Reed of Webberville, David (Linda) Reed of Alaska, Edwin (Carolyn) Reed, of DeWitt, Thomas (Diane) Reed of Kimball, Joseph Reed, FSC of New York; 28 grandchildren; and 21 great-grandchildren. Bill owned and operated Reed Insurance Agency in DeWitt for 30 years. He was a charter member of DeWitt Breakfast Lions Club, Msgr. Stotenbur Council #7237, St. Francis 4th Degree Assembly #2982, and Catholic Community of St. Jude. He was also active on the DeWitt School Board for 12 years and worked part time for Gorsline Runciman Funeral Homes. Bill affectionately referred to Joyce as “my bride” in the many stories he told, and always enjoyed having a good time with his family and friends.
